Battery Testing and Cold Weather Performance
Your truck's battery works harder in wintertime than any other period, yet cool temperature levels dramatically lower its cranking power. A battery operating at peak performance in summer season sheds virtually half its toughness when temperature levels go down to absolutely no degrees. Testing your battery's charge and overall problem before wintertime gets here protects against those discouraging early mornings when your vehicle refuses to begin in the driveway.
A lot of batteries last between 3 to 5 years under typical problems, yet Michigan winters months can reduce that life expectancy considerably. Examine the production date stamped on your battery instance to identify its age. If your battery comes close to the three-year mark, consider replacement rather than risking failing during the chilliest months. Tidy any corrosion from battery terminals using a cord brush and ensure connections continue to be tight and protected.
Booster cable are entitled to evaluation as well, as harmed or frayed wires avoid proper current flow to the starter. Seek cracks in the insulation or green deterioration accumulation around link points. Fluid Checks and Winter-Grade Products
Engine oil density modifications substantially with temperature, and making use of the correct thickness for winter months driving keeps your engine properly lubed throughout chilly beginnings. Changing to a winter-grade oil with reduced viscosity aids your engine turn over even more easily when temperatures drop. Examine your proprietor's manual for producer referrals details to your vehicle version and driving conditions.
Coolant safeguards your engine from cold damage while maintaining optimal operating temperature during wintertime driving. Test your coolant's freeze protection level using a cost-effective tester readily available at any automobile components shop. The mixture ought to shield down to at least adverse 30 levels for Michigan winters. If your coolant appears rustic or polluted, flush the system entirely and re-fill with fresh antifreeze mixed to the proper concentration.
Windshield washer fluid ends up being crucial during cold weather when roadway spray and salt regularly layer your windshield. Common washing machine liquid ices up solid in Michigan temperatures, leaving you not able to clean your windshield when presence matters most. Replace your storage tank materials with winter-formula washing machine liquid ranked for subzero temperatures. Fill the tank completely, as you'll utilize substantially a lot more fluid during winter season than summer season driving.
Tire Selection and Tread Depth Evaluation
Tire efficiency separates secure wintertime driving from hazardous situations on snow and frozen roads. All-season tires function appropriately in moderate problems however struggle to give enough traction when roadways turn treacherous. Dedicated winter tires make use of specialized rubber compounds that remain flexible in cool temperature levels and tread patterns developed particularly for snow and ice grip.
Examine your existing tires' step deepness by inserting a penny into the tread grooves with Lincoln's head pointing downward. If you can see the top of Lincoln's head, your tires have put on below safe levels for winter season driving and require replacement. Michigan law doesn't mandate particular walk depths, however security professionals suggest at least 6/32 of an inch for wintertime grip.
Tire pressure drops around one extra pound per square inch for every 10-degree temperature level decrease. Inspect your tire pressure weekly throughout loss and winter season, getting used to the supplier's suggested PSI listed on the sticker inside your vehicle driver's door jamb. Underinflated tires decrease traction and fuel economic situation while putting on unevenly, while overinflated tires provide much less contact with the road surface.

Brake System Inspection and Maintenance
Your vehicle's stopping system faces intense demands during winter months driving, when stopping ranges enhance on unsafe surface areas. Set up a thorough brake assessment that consists of measuring pad and blades density, inspecting brake liquid problem, and checking out all hydraulic lines for leaks or damage. Used brake pads develop longer quiting distances also on completely dry pavement and come to be harmful on snow-covered roads.
Brake liquid soaks up wetness with time, which decreases its boiling point and can create brake discolor during prolonged use. If your brake liquid appears dark or infected, flush the entire system and change it with fresh fluid. Tidy brake fluid maintains constant pedal feel and trustworthy quiting power despite weather.
Anti-lock braking systems stop wheel lockup throughout emergency quits on slippery surfaces, yet they only function properly when all components function correctly. Odd sounds, alerting lights, or unusual pedal feel show prospective ABS issues that require specialist diagnosis. Do not disregard these warning signs, as ABS supplies critical safety and security advantages during wintertime driving.

4x4 System Verification
Trucks outfitted with 4x4 or all-wheel drive systems offer considerable benefits on snow-covered roads, yet these systems require regular usage and maintenance to function accurately. Engage your four-wheel drive system month-to-month throughout the year to maintain elements lubed and stop binding when you need the system during winter months.
Follow your owner's hands-on instructions for proper four-wheel drive engagement. Some systems allow shifting while relocating, while others call for a full stop before engaging four-wheel drive setting. Understanding your system's operation prevents potential damage from incorrect usage. Never drive in four-wheel drive setting on completely dry sidewalk, as this develops drivetrain binding that harms transfer instance elements.
Transfer situation fluid lubricates the gears that power all 4 wheels and calls for routine transforming according to your maintenance schedule. Overlooking this service results in early wear and prospective failure during winter season when you need 4x4 most. Examine liquid degree and condition according to your proprietor's hand-operated requirements.
Undercarriage Protection and Rust Prevention
Road salt applied heavily throughout Taylor and bordering areas throughout winter months develops a harsh setting that attacks your vehicle's undercarriage. Framework rails, brake lines, exhaust components, and suspension components all deal with consistent salt exposure that accelerates corrosion development. Taking precautionary actions before winter season safeguards these crucial parts from rust damages.
Numerous truck proprietors apply undercoating items that create a protective barrier between steel surface areas and roadway salt. Oil-based undercoatings penetrate into existing surface area corrosion and supply recurring defense throughout cold weather. Some items need yearly application, while others supply multi-year defense with a solitary therapy.
Cleaning your vehicle frequently during winter season removes salt accumulation before it causes permanent damage. Focus on the undercarriage, wheel wells, and reduced body panels where salt and slush collect. Several automated auto cleans offer undercarriage spray alternatives that blow up away salt accumulation from areas you can not easily get to. Make undercarriage cleaning a regular part of your winter upkeep routine as opposed to waiting up until spring.
Emergency Situation Kit Preparation for Winter Travel
Even properly preserved trucks occasionally break down or get stuck in wintertime weather. Setting up an emergency situation kit before winter shows up gives important materials if you find yourself stranded in cool problems. Store these products in a weatherproof container that remains in your vehicle throughout the period.
Consist of a heavy covering or resting bag ranked for cool temperatures, as hypothermia ends up being a danger if your vehicle loses heat while you await assistance. Pack additional gloves, hats, and warm socks that stay completely dry even if your routine apparel ends up being wet from snow or slush. Hand and foot warmers give short-term warmth throughout extended waits and use up marginal storage space.
A folding shovel assists you dig out if your vehicle comes to be embeded deep snow. Sand or feline clutter provides traction when your tires spin on ice. Jumper cords or a mobile dive starter gets you moving if your battery fails. Keep a flashlight with fresh batteries, standard devices, and an emergency treatment package as common emergency situation tools.
Food and water sustain you during unforeseen delays caused by mishaps or road closures. Granola bars, nuts, and other non-perishable snacks provide energy without refrigeration. Store several bottles of water, understanding that they might freeze in extreme chilly however will thaw if required.
Gas System Considerations for Cold Weather
Keeping a minimum of a fifty percent container of gas throughout winter season avoids several cold-weather issues. Condensation types inside partially empty gas containers when temperature levels change, and this water can freeze in gas lines and avoid your engine from starting. Maintaining your container fuller lessens airspace where condensation develops.
Diesel vehicle owners encounter added winter season obstacles, as diesel fuel gels when temperature levels drop listed below particular thresholds. Winter-blend diesel fuel includes ingredients that avoid gelling in cool problems, but severe temperatures still trigger issues. Including a diesel fuel antigel item per container provides additional protection during the chilliest durations. Some drivers who operate in serious problems include antigel items starting in November and continue through March.
Fuel filters trap water and impurities prior to they reach your engine, yet these filters can clog with ice crystals in wintertime problems. Change your gas filter prior to winter months if it comes close to the suggested service interval. Bring an extra fuel filter and standard tools to change it roadside can obtain you running again if ice blocks fuel flow during a journey.
